Amravati riots: Top BJP leaders under house arrest
-1.webp)
In the aftermath of the communal violence, which broke out on Sunday, November 13, in Amravati, a four-day curfew and Internet shutdown was imposed to control the situation.
However, looking at the severity of the current prevailing situations, the Amravati administration extended the curfew to four towns of the district.
The curfew is now expanded to cover Morshi, Warud, Achalpur and Anjangaon Surji towns of the Amravati district, a top police official said.
Police detained former Maharashtra Agriculture Minister Anil Bonde, MLC Pravin Pote and Amravati rural BJP president Nivedita Chaudhari for taking out a rally in protest against Fridays stone-pelting.
A top source told Nation Next that they are under house arrest as of now and are well taken care of.
A total of eight BJP activists were detained in Warud and Shendurjanaghat villages for raising slogans. Reportedly, 50 arrests were made till date in this case.
Here’s what happened:
On Friday, November 12, a large group from the Muslim community called for a ?bandh? in Amravati. Reportedly, they targeted Hindu shops and vandalized them at large.
This march was carried out in protest against the recent Tripura incident.
In response to this, many Hindu and political organisations including the BJP, called for a bandh on, Sunday, November 14. Communal violence broke out as members of the Hindu-Muslim community clashed with each other.
Reportedly, the agitated mob vandalised Hindu, Muslim shops and establishments. They also set ablaze vehicles and broke-in public properties.
As per Guardian Minister Yashomati Thakur, Amravati is under control as of now and necessary steps are currently being taken to maintain peace and harmony.
Reportedly, no loss of life was reported due to the violence. However, many were gravely injured.

SHOCKER: 4 gang rape monitor lizard in Maharashtra, record act on phone; get arrested

Monitor Lizard (Photo: Wikimedia Commons)
In the most unbelievable incident ever, four men were arrested for allegedly raping a Bengal monitor lizard in Sahyadri Tiger Reserve (STR). The reserve is spread over four districts of Satara, Sangli, Kolhapur and Ratnagiri in Maharashtra.
The gruesome incident took place at Gothane village in Ratnagiri district on March 31 when the four accused illegally entered Chandoli National Park (part of the reserve). One of the four was also carrying a gun for hunting.
The Maharashtra Forest Department checked the mobile phone of one of the accused and that’s when he learnt about the incident. The officials found the recording of the act, which showed the accused allegedly gang-raping the monitor lizard.
A forest official said the four accused were identified as Sandeep Tukaram Pawar, Mangesh Kamtekar, Akshay Kamtekar and Ramesh Ghag.
The official said, “During the investigation, the forest officials found that the accused had allegedly raped a Bengal monitor lizard. Their act was also recorded in a mobile phone of one of the accused persons. We have recovered all the related evidence from the accused and they were granted forest department custody initially, but are out on bail now. They have been asked to mark their presence before the forest officer, who is probing the case, every Monday.”
“The four accused have been booked under various sections of the Wild Life (Protection) Act, 1972,” said field director of Sahyadri Tiger Reserve (STR), Nanasaheb Ladkat.

ED attaches Sanjay Raut’s properties in ₹1034 crore Patra Chawl land scam case; Raut tweets ‘Asatyamev Jayate’

Sanjay Raut
Enforcement Directorate (ED), on Tuesday, under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A), attached Shiv Sena leader and Rajya Sabha MP Sanjay Raut’s property in ₹1034 crore Patra Chawl land scam case. The ED, in February, had also arrested his close friend Pravin Raut.
The ED attached Raut’s plot in Alibaug and one flat in Mumbai’s Dadar area.
After ED attached Raut’s properties, the latter tweeted, “Asatyamev Jayate (the lies win)”
The attachment is linked to a money laundering probe linked to an alleged scam related to the re-development of a chawl in Mumbai.
